How often does a chimney really need to be cleaned in Oregon?

In Oregon, annual chimney inspections are recommended. The actual cleaning frequency depends on how often you use your fireplace or heating stove. For homes that experience regular use during the cooler, wetter months, an annual cleaning is often necessary to prevent buildup.

What are the signs of a dirty chimney?

Look for a buildup of dark, tar-like residue (creosote) inside your fireplace or chimney flue. If smoke is backing up into your home instead of venting outside, or if you notice a burning smell when the fireplace is not in use, your chimney likely needs professional cleaning.
